General Info
DELRIN ® (unfilled) homopolymer grades offers slightly higher mechanical properties than acetal copolymer, but may contain a low density center (also known as "center line porosity") especially in large cross-sections. Acetal homopolymer also has slightly less chemical resistance than copolymer acetal. Delrin ® is ideal for small diameter, thin-walled bushings that benefit from the additional strength and rigidity of homopolymer acetal. Delrin ® is available in BLACK & NATURAL colors.

Key Properties
- Higher Strength & Stiffness than Copolymer Acetal
- Wear Resistance in Wet Environments
- Low H2O Absorption
- Excellent Machinability
Limitations
- Wear Resistance in Dry Environments
- Lower Temperature Stability (to 180 F)
- Poor Resistance to Strong Acids and Alkalies
- Higher Formaldehyde Outgassing than Copolymer Acetal
- Centerline Porosity - low density (porosity) center, especially in larger cross sections.
Applications
- Bushings & Bearings
- Gears & Sprockets
- Manifolds
- Pump & Valve Components
- Rollers
- Wear Strips
